Category Identification
The category that Aileen Wuornos identifies with is the control category. Control killers may have been abused or witnessed violence which sparked their murders. The main objective for this type of serial killer is to gain and exert power over their victim. Such killers are sometimes abused as children, leaving them with feelings of powerlessness and inadequacy as adults. Many power or control-motivated killers sexually abuse their victims, but they differ from hedonistic killers in that rape is not motivated by lust (as it would be with a lust murder) but as simply another form of dominating the victim. (Scribd, 2015).
Wuornos was a sex worker who claimed that while working, her clients had raped or had attempted to rape her. She also claimed that she killed in self defense. Intensely sexually and physically abused as child and teeanger, Wuornos had significant trust issues and may have believed her clients were attempting to rape her. |
